If you launch the cannonball from the ground instead (hi=0), what does that change in the original equation?
ikadub [295]

Answer:

  the value of hi changes from 58 to 0:

  h(t) = -4.9t^2 +19.8t

Step-by-step explanation:

If the initial height changes, then the term in the equation that represents that height will change. The initial height term is hi, so it changes from 58 to 0.

  h(t)=-4.9t^2+19.8t+0\\\\\boxed{h(t)=-4.9t^2+19.8t}

What is the sum of the interior angles of a hexagon?
Gala2k [10]

Hello!

So, every interior angle of a regular hexagon measures 120 degrees.

There are six interior angles of a hexagon, so you have to multiply 120 by 6.

120 x 6 = 720

So, the answer to your question is that the sum of the interior angles of a hexagon is 720 degrees.
